## Step 4 — Pool configuration (Tarnbridge deploy)

Reviewer: confirm pool sizing before approving. Grainloft's API tier opens one pool per worker; cap at 12 connections or the Velmara primary saturates. Set POOL_MIN=2, POOL_MAX=12, idle timeout 30s. Do not enable statement caching yet — pending the Velmara 9 upgrade. Verify the migration job uses the read replica, not the primary. The pooler authenticates to Velmara with a dedicated role, and that role's password belongs on the next line of the env file.

sealed setting: VAULT_KEY20=c8ea1e419912889df6b4

Subject: Catalogue import — Shelfern release 4.2

Team,

The Shelfern catalogue importer now handles the Dunmoor Library's MARC-variant exports without the manual remapping step. Batch size caps at 50k records; larger files split automatically. New folks: failed rows land in the quarantine table, not the dead-letter queue — check there first. Rollback is a config flip, not a redeploy. Staging import of the full Dunmoor set completed clean this morning on the following build.

trace token, tawep-fahif: htk3_b58

## Authentication

The Ferrowline queue's log-compaction worker calls the internal Vaultgate service to fetch retention policies before each compaction pass. As a contractor you won't need production access; the sandbox cluster is sufficient for testing compaction thresholds and tombstone cleanup. Set the worker's auth header from the key in your environment file. For sandbox work, the shared internal key you should use is listed below.

gateway credential: kto23_LX9A4ys6i4nzHtpOLNLodKK

Hey Priya — handing off the Lanternfish metrics sidecar before I'm out. It scrapes the app pods every 15s, batches, and ships to the Corvid aggregator over mTLS. Flush interval is tuned down to 5s during deploys, so expect spikier traffic then. Known quirk: it drops counters silently if the buffer fills, so watch the overflow gauge. For the security review, you'll want access to the sealed ops vault. The recovery passphrase that unseals it is:

unlock words, hahip-baduf: holwyn-istath-julvan